FINAL JEOPARDY! CATEGORY
IN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S

FINAL JEOPARDY! CLUE
The "effect" named for this company founded in 1943 refers to increased value of a product to a consumer whose own labor is needed

Amal Dorai: 14300+14300=28600 (2x = $43,200)
Bonnie Hagan: 9800+9795=19595
Jon Marshall: 21000-7777=13223

Correct response:
Spoiler
IKEA (Jon – Chia Pet Effect)
